If you fish at night, consider using a lighted bobber. There is a small bulb within the bobber to help fish be more visible when they bite. Once a fish takes a nibble, the bobber jumps up on the surface, letting the fisherman know something has been hooked.

Look for a spot where fish are congregating, and then cast your hook in a place upstream from that area. Your hook will drag past the fish. This looks natural and can can do as much, or more, to attract a fish as your choice in bait can. For areas with an obstruction, this method is very useful.

There is nothing more important to fishing than having a sharp fishing hook. A sharp fishing hook snags the fish and holds it on-line until you reel it in for the catch. Make sure to check your hook sharpness regularly and replace them as needed.

In the winter, it is advised to make use of sinkers when you’re fishing. Using sinkers weighs down your line, letting the bait sink deep into the less-frigid water where fish hide out during the winter. The amount and size of the sinkers you use depends on how deep the water is.

Before you leave to go fishing, always remember to check the weather report to make sure you are going to be safe. Many fishermen prefer to bring a small radio on the boat because it allows them to remain updated on developing weather conditions.

If your favorite lure is letting too many fish get by you, consider checking your hooks. Many fishermen do not realize that hooks can become blunt or twisted which makes fish harder to catch. Bass are sometimes easily caught by grubs. These tiny lures can help you catch some big fish. Both largemouth and smallmouth bass can be caught successfully using grubs. If you’re in a highland reservoir, they’re perfect.

It is usually a good idea to invest in a solid, quality fishing rod. Rods of lower quality may snap under pressure, and they are not tested as strenuously as those of higher quality. In the long run, investing in a quality rod is more cost-effective.

When a large fish that you’ve hooked is attempting to get away, it is important to remain calm. Remember not to reel it in while it swims away. Relax your line’s drag and allow the fish to run, letting your pole do the work. Once your hook is set inside the fish, remember to set your drag. Your rod should be at about a 45 degree angle to the water and you should aim it at the fish.

Don’t forget a net to catch the fish on your next fishing excursion. Using a net makes it much easier to secure jumpy fish. A fishing net will help you reduce the chance of losing the fish and keep it from returning to the water.
